On the night of February 15, 2025, a tragic stampede at New Delhi Railway Station resulted in the deaths of at least 18 individuals and left 15 others injured. The majority of the victims were women, and a 7-year-old child was also among the deceased. The incident occurred around 8:00 PM local time, as thousands of passengers were attempting to board trains to Prayagraj for the Maha Kumbh festival.
Incident Details:
The stampede was triggered by an announcement regarding a change in train platforms, leading to confusion among passengers. As people rushed to the new platform, the crowd became uncontrollable, resulting in a tragic loss of life. Eyewitnesses reported that individuals slipped and fell on the footbridge connecting the platforms, causing a domino effect that led to numerous casualties.
Victims and Injuries:
Among the deceased, 14 were women, and a 7-year-old child was also reported dead. The injured were promptly transported to Lok Nayak Jai Prakash Narain Hospital for medical treatment. Official Responses:
Prime Minister Narendra Modi expressed his deep sorrow over the incident, offering condolences to the bereaved families. He stated, “I am deeply anguished by the loss of lives in the stampede at New Delhi Railway Station. My heartfelt condolences to the families of the deceased.” Railway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w has ordered a thorough investigation to determine the cause of the stampede and to prevent such incidents in the future.
Investigation and Findings:
Preliminary investigations suggest that the confusion arose due to the announcement of the ‘Prayagraj Special’ arriving at Platform 16, which led passengers to believe that their train was arriving at a different platform. This misunderstanding caused a surge of people moving towards Platform 16, resulting in the stampede. Delhi Police sources have indicated that the similarity in train names contributed to the confusion.
Compensation and Support:
In response to the tragedy, the Railway Ministry has announced an ex-gratia payment to the families of the deceased and the injured. The exact amount of compensation is yet to be disclosed, but authorities have assured that all necessary support will be provided to the affected individuals.
